An ONT and an ONU are the same things. Both devices serve as the bridge between the end-user and the Passive Optical Network. The ONU can effectively improve the uplink bandwidth utilization of the entire system and configure channel bandwidth based on the network application environment and service characteristics. In this way, it can carry as many terminal users as possible without affecting the communication efficiency.

    The STC-QSFPDD-DR4-500M optical transceiver provides high-speed 400Gbps Ethernet connectivity over parallel single-mode fiber (SMF) up to 500 meters. It uses four 100G PAM4 optical lanes operating at 1310nm and complies with IEEE 802. 3bs 400GBASE-DR4 and QSFP-DD MSA standards.
